Preventing "orphan" right smartquotes?

Is there a way to prevent the right hand side smart quote mark from ending up alone and orphaned on the next line?

So for example:

"Friends, Romans, Countrymen, lend me your ears.
"
could be forced to:

"Friends, Romans, Countrymen, lend me your
ears."

(This problem tends to come up for me on the iPhone a lot, because of the relatively short line lengths displayed)
